I submitted my paperwork and supporting docs on 12/7. I was out of town the following week so I did not get finger prints done until 12/12.

Today I got a letter in the mail dated 12/10 that stated that they had no received my prints (which at that point they had not). I took this as an opportunity to call to ensure they received the prints. The nice lady :tiphat: I spoke with said that they had received them this morning and that the background check was underway. She said that it would be about 60 days!! :shock: - I hope that is just a canned response based on the maximum allowed time because others are getting theirs much faster! :rules:

1/07 UPDATE: Called DPS to check on status; was told "there was some sort of glitch regarding your background check" and that "the file is being processed".

In my best "adult ego state of mind", I calmly requested clarification since I've had no issues whatsoever in my background or any 'glitches' ever appear in other background checks, including 2 within the past 60 days. The DPS representative explained that apparently one of their "data entry technicians had mistakenly indicated my application included "self reported" arrests during the last 10 years. Instead of entering "N" in the internal form, the technician must have, in error, entered "Y" in the block".

As a result, the trooper working my file began a search for more information regarding a "self-reported arrest" that I never had or ever reported. After not finding a record of any previous arrest, the officer (I'm assuming) double-checked my original application and discovered the discrepancy.

What next and how do I proceed? I was told to "just keep doing what you're doing, check the status for updates; everything is good and we have everything we need to process your file". Hmmm...okay, the exercise in patience will continue.

Lessons learned: (1) Mr. Murphy is still alive and lives nearby...lol...(2) Fat-fingers can strike anywhere, anytime. (3) "Trust but verify"--President Ronald Reagan;
